Ticket: config drift on the Lintrose baseline file. Support flagged that three customer environments are failing static-analysis checks that pass in CI. Turns out their deployed baseline file drifted from what we ship — someone hand-edited suppressions months ago. Fix is to re-sync against the canonical baseline. For reference, the correct analyzer settings are the following.

deployment values, kajep-kageg:
[praix]
host = praix.paliqcorp.corp
user = praix_svc
database = praix_prod

INSURANCE RENEWAL — Managers Only

Scope: Fennick Instruments group policy, renewing end of Q2. Carrier: Bastional Mutual. Premium up 14% on last year, driven by the Redhollow warehouse claim. Coverage unchanged except cyber sub-limit, which doubles. Action for sales leads: do not commit to client indemnity terms above standard until renewal binds. Broker review meeting set for week 19. Renewal documents sit in the managers' shared folder. Questions via your department head only. Wider commercial implications are set out in the note below.

board note of kageg-bahof: The renewal with Holwynax Holdings closes at $2 million a year, 5 percent below the last contract. Project Ulaath slips by two quarters because of the supplier delay.

**Q: How does the support team get in during night shifts?**

Night-shift access at the Dunmoor Street office runs through the side entrance on the loading court; the main doors lock at 20:00. Support staff on the Larkspur rota are pre-cleared — no sign-in required, but the motion lights take a few seconds. Escalate faults to the overnight security post. The side-door keypad accepts the code listed below.

door code, yagap-bahof: bdg-O-05